I’ve never had a Brazilian-Style Strong Ale before, but #XichaBrewing brewed this one in collaboration with Cheers to the Land, a partnership between craft brewers and the #OregonAgriculturalTrust. These beers are brewed with ingredients grown on #Oregon farms and help highlight the importance of protecting Oregon’s farm land.
This #beer is 8% ABV, and brewed with Cara Cara oranges, cane sugar, and piloncillo sugar. It’s quite tasty and unique, one worth seeking out. Cheers!

It's #CincoDeMayo today, and I'm giving a nod to the day with the enjoyment of these two Mexican-style lagers: Chela from #XichaBrewing, brewed with corn in the lighter style; and Muy Chido from #CascadeLakesBrewing, darker with Vienna lager influences. I hope everyone is enjoying similar libations and staying safe today! Cheers! 🍻
